Couldn't find exactly the pieces I needed to build a plexiglass stand alone enclosure around my Kossel Mini, so created some quickly myself. The legs will raise enclosure 5cm above the bottom of printer so the electronics below is not overheated. I have legs on the printer that are about 15mm high. So please cut 15mm off legs if you do not have legs below printer.
Print with atleast 20% infill.
Plexiglass Enclosure (square hole at back for filament feeder)
1x 32x60cm bakplate
1x 32x58cm door (2cm shorter to go clear of LCD display)
2x 29x60cm sideplates
1x 32x29,8cm top (used 4mm plexi)
